Transaction 8f597e671c9aba9571b9343cc204e661709a6639d97790651b02e28ee049ab71
1 Input
1 Output
-
8f597e671c9aba9571b9343cc204e661709a6639d97790651b02e28ee049ab71:0
- value
- 8715815
- script pubkey
- OP_0 OP_PUSHBYTES_20 cda518bc2da715c9bdb0ba5ec262106b7b3a5dca
- address
- bc1qekj330pd5u2un0dshf0vycssddan5hw27jn85m